Output 52e278d76b95e981f8792b037b21a5ce9ec41957f4ec4b94ba88feaccf2d5919:3

value
1571160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83df32e1f6be0cd06fa2f951d1a57ee8d6c4b037 OP_EQUAL
address
3DiHpo5cAXFEXjdaETTsnWyHCbhiPES5Fa
transaction
52e278d76b95e981f8792b037b21a5ce9ec41957f4ec4b94ba88feaccf2d5919
spent
true